The Global Landscape of Gambling Regulations
The realm of gambling regulations varies significantly from one country to another, influenced by cultural, economic, and political factors. Some nations have embraced gambling, establishing comprehensive legal frameworks to regulate it, while others maintain strict prohibitions. For instance, in places like the United Kingdom, gambling is legal and well-regulated, promoting a safe environment for players. On the contrary, countries such as Saudi Arabia enforce a complete ban on all forms of gambling, reflecting cultural and religious beliefs. Understanding these differences is crucial for anyone looking to engage in gambling activities internationally, especially as players analyze odds and probabilities alongside various regulations. Additionally, the rise of online gambling has added another layer of complexity to these regulations. As more players turn to the internet for their gambling needs, many governments are grappling with how to regulate an industry that transcends borders. The European Union, for instance, allows member states to regulate online gambling independently, leading to a patchwork of laws that can confuse players and operators alike.
Legal frameworks are further complicated by ongoing changes in legislation and the introduction of new technologies such as cryptocurrency and blockchain. Countries are constantly revising their gambling laws to adapt to evolving market conditions and consumer preferences. As such, players and operators must stay informed about the latest developments to navigate this complex landscape effectively. This constant evolution signifies that what is legal today may change tomorrow, making vigilance essential.
The Role of Licensing and Regulation
Licensing is a critical component of the gambling industry, serving as a means of ensuring that operators adhere to legal standards. Countries that permit gambling often require operators to obtain licenses from regulatory authorities, which impose strict guidelines to protect consumers and ensure fair play. For example, the Malta Gaming Authority and the UK Gambling Commission are two prominent regulators that set high standards for transparency and player protection.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in hefty fines or loss of license.
Moreover, a reputable license serves as a badge of credibility for online casinos and sportsbooks, providing players with a sense of security. Players are advised to check the licensing status of any gambling site they choose to use. This not only helps in ensuring a fair gaming environment but also safeguards against fraud. Without proper licensing, players may find themselves vulnerable to unscrupulous operators who may engage in dishonest practices.
The importance of regulation extends beyond just licensing; it also encompasses measures for responsible gaming. Many jurisdictions mandate that licensed operators implement tools to help players manage their gambling habits, such as self-exclusion options and limits on deposits. Such regulations are vital in fostering a safer gambling environment and ensuring that players engage in gambling responsibly. By promoting accountability within the industry, these measures aim to prevent problem gambling and protect vulnerable individuals.
Emerging Trends in Global Gambling Legislation
As society evolves, so too does the approach to gambling legislation. One notable trend is the increasing acceptance of online gambling, spurred by advancements in technology and shifts in public perception. Countries that were once staunchly opposed to gambling are beginning to explore legalization as a means of boosting tourism and generating tax revenue. For instance, several U.S. states have recently legalized sports betting, recognizing its potential for economic benefits.
Additionally, the advent of mobile gaming has revolutionized the gambling industry, leading to new regulatory challenges. Governments are tasked with creating laws that address the unique aspects of mobile gambling, such as location-based services and in-app purchases. As more players opt for mobile platforms, regulatory bodies must adapt to these changes to ensure consumer protection and fair practices. This requires a collaborative approach among governments, operators, and technology providers.
Another emerging trend is the integration of technology into gambling regulations, particularly with the rise of blockchain and cryptocurrencies. Some countries are beginning to recognize the potential for these technologies to enhance transparency and security in gambling transactions. By leveraging blockchain, operators can offer players a more secure and accountable experience. However, this also raises questions about how existing laws will adapt to these innovations, illustrating the need for ongoing dialogue and adaptation within the regulatory landscape.
The Impact of Culture on Gambling Legislation
Cultural attitudes toward gambling play a significant role in shaping regulations around the globe. In some countries, gambling is seen as a leisure activity and a form of entertainment, while in others, it is viewed as a vice that should be restricted or banned altogether. For example, countries in East Asia, such as Macau and Singapore, have developed robust gambling industries that attract millions of tourists, reflecting a cultural acceptance of gaming as part of social life.
Conversely, in many Middle Eastern countries, gambling is heavily stigmatized, and strict laws are enforced to discourage participation. This cultural perception influences not just national policies but also the implementation of gambling laws. Countries with more relaxed cultural attitudes may adopt regulations that facilitate growth and innovation in the industry, whereas more conservative nations prioritize strict prohibitions and limitations.
Moreover, globalization has led to a blending of cultural perspectives on gambling, with some nations reconsidering their stance. This has resulted in a growing trend of international collaboration on gambling regulation, as countries share best practices and seek to create a unified approach to address cross-border gambling issues. Such collaboration is essential for fostering a regulated environment that can adapt to the complexities of a globalized gambling market.
